Images not loading for learner
I had a learner reach out stating they could not see the images. However, I have no issues on my end. Could it be the learners internet connection? Is this a Rise issue? The images are from Shutterst...

I have a whole slew of recommendations 😀
- If the student is using a mobile device (like a tablet), then Review 360 doesn't work very well. If students don't have to write comments, I recommend using Rise's Quick Share feature rather than Review 360 since it works well on mobile.
- It may be a browser issue; you can have the student try using private/incognito mode and see if that clears things up, or a different browser entirely.
- Running a speed test can also tell you whether they're on a slower connection that can muck up images.
- Since this is a stock image and a probably fairly large file, I recommend leaving the Preserve File Quality option unchecked, if this wasn't done initially. Or maybe replace with a more compressed version to lower the file size.
